Output efbf30e6a0ea0195c9c7a26d90af3a935f742f1f332e431d08588ed42ccf4e2e:1

value
29353
script pubkey
OP_0 OP_PUSHBYTES_20 ba3086cfd912d3188892c83650d30c22c8e6be1e
address
bc1qhgcgdn7eztf33zyjeqm9p5cvytywd0s7j54mv0
transaction
efbf30e6a0ea0195c9c7a26d90af3a935f742f1f332e431d08588ed42ccf4e2e
spent
true